Output c59a263eb1d6269b34f1e9b543efc94a4a040cc20884882392dcbf4a0a0229ea:0

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9c298f0dd838cd0fabe8af03e928170903f4fa4 OP_EQUAL
address
3L5pry5z6H7A4wKub2kCs1a9gy6NkCjUh3
transaction
c59a263eb1d6269b34f1e9b543efc94a4a040cc20884882392dcbf4a0a0229ea
spent
true